Fracas

Fracas noun - A physical dispute between opposing individuals or groups.
Usage example: the police broke up the fracas in the bar and threw both combatants in the lockup

Hassle

Hassle noun - A physical dispute between opposing individuals or groups.
Usage example: the moment the police arrived, the hassle broke up, and no one was seriously injured

Fracas and hassle are semantically related in fight topic. Sometimes you can use "Fracas" instead a noun "Hassle", if it concerns topics such as scuffle, tussle.
